What is Nikko AM Investment Form

The Nikko AM-Tyndall Equities Fund Additional Investment Form is a financial document used by investors to submit additional investments into selected Nikko AM-Tyndall Equities Funds.

Comprehensive Guide to Nikko AM Investment Form

What is the Nikko AM-Tyndall Equities Fund Additional Investment Form?

The Nikko AM-Tyndall Equities Fund Additional Investment Form is a crucial document for investors aiming to increase their investments in the Nikko AM-Tyndall Equities Fund. This form serves to facilitate additional purchases while ensuring that both investor and account holder signatures are obtained to validate the transaction. Understanding its purpose is vital for effective investment strategies.

Key Features of the Nikko AM-Tyndall Equities Fund Additional Investment Form

  • Contains fillable fields for investor number, investment amount, and payment method.
  • Includes sections for direct debit requests and adviser fees.
  • Designed with clarity and simplicity for an easy user experience.
